Output d4d643bfd53ef32ca78ff9e6af6e271254b3f0b85eb60ca6ebdab89e9d126e3d:43

value
869676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3486a4dbf564f410d2305d59993902f08a4a24a2 OP_EQUAL
address
36UkMkGNPtAqN7X8TUwHt7zb6TSmHLvxDb
transaction
d4d643bfd53ef32ca78ff9e6af6e271254b3f0b85eb60ca6ebdab89e9d126e3d
spent
true